Як округлити до найближчих 10 в Excel

click fraud protection
Зміна продажів відображатиметься в окулярах

Клацніть клітинку та натисніть «F2», щоб відобразити її формулу замість результату.

Авторство зображення: nikoniko_happy/iStock/Getty Images

Математичні функції Excel включають кілька варіантів округлення чисел, зокрема ROUND, RUNDUP, MROUND і CEILING, кожна з яких дещо відрізняється за призначенням і синтаксисом. Для округлення до найближчих 10 найкраще працює CEILING, тоді як MROUND може округлити до найближчих 10 в будь-якому напрямку. ROUND і ROUNDUP краще працюють для округлення десяткових дробів, але вони також можуть округлити до найближчих 10 за допомогою обхідного способу. Ви можете використовувати будь-яку з цих функцій окремо для округлення одного числа або в поєднанні з посиланнями на клітинку для округлення всього набору існуючих даних.

Округлення зі стелею

Функція CEILING в Excel завжди округляє до вказаного значення, що робить її найкращим способом округлення до найближчих 10. Формула CEILING вимагає двох змінних: вихідне число і відстань для його округлення. Наприклад, щоб округлити число 12 до 20, введіть "=CEILING(12, 10)" (без лапок) у клітинку. Незалежно від того, яке число ви хочете округлити, змініть лише першу змінну у формулі. Другий, «10», наказує Excel округлити до найближчих 10, тому, поки ваша мета залишається округлити до найближчих 10, вам ніколи не потрібно її коригувати.

Відео дня

Округлення за допомогою MRound

MROUND, скорочення від Multiple Round, округлює одне число до найближчого кратного іншого числа. На практиці MROUND працює майже так само, як CEILING, за винятком того, що він може округлювати вгору або вниз - формула "=MROUND(12, 10)" дає результат 10, тоді як "=MROUND(17,10)" дає 20. Використовуйте MROUND замість CEILING лише тоді, коли ви хочете округлити до найближчих 10, а не округляти в більшу сторону.

Розуміння раундів і раундів

Найпростіші функції округлення Excel, ROUND і ROUNDUP, зазвичай не працюють для округлення до найближчих 10. Ці функції призначені для округлення додаткових десяткових знаків. Наприклад, "=ROUND(1.2, 0)" округляє від 1,2 до 0 знаків після коми, утворюючи 1. ROUNDUP працює аналогічно, але в цьому випадку перетворить 1.2 на 2. Ви можете використовувати трюк, щоб застосувати ROUND або ROUNDUP для округлення до найближчих 10: спочатку поділіть внутрішнє число на 10, а потім помножте всю функцію на 10, наприклад "=ОКРУГ (12/10, 0)*10." Це працює, перетворюючи вибране число, 12, на 1.2. Функція округляє від 1,2 до 2, які формула множить на 10, одержуючи бажаний результат, 20. Однак якщо ви не хочете використовувати ROUND або ROUNDUP з якоїсь конкретної причини, швидше просто використовувати MROUND або CEILING.

Швидке округлення цілих аркушів

Яку б формулу ви не вибрали, вам потрібно ввести її в кожну клітинку, яку потрібно округлити, що вимагає багато роботи, якщо у вас уже є цілий аркуш даних. Замість того, щоб переписувати кожну клітинку, відкрийте чистий аркуш у тій самій книзі, напишіть одну ітерацію формули, використовуючи посилання на клітинку, а потім заповніть решту аркуша. Наприклад, якщо ви хочете округлити 50 рядків даних, уже введених у стовпець A аркуша 1, введіть "=СТЕЛЯ(Лист1!A1, 10)" у клітинку A1 на аркуші 2, а потім перетягніть маркер заповнення на 50 клітинок вниз. Стовпець на Аркуші2 ідеально відповідатиме стовпцю на Аркуші1, але округлений в більшу сторону. Далі скопіюйте весь стовпець на Аркуш2, клацніть правою кнопкою миші заголовок цього ж стовпця та виберіть «Значення» з параметрів вставки. Це замінює формули в кожній клітинці статичними округленими значеннями, що дає змогу змінювати або видаляти Аркуш1 без втрати чисел на Аркуші2.